Frosolone
Frosolone is a comune in the Province of Isernia in the Italian region Molise, located about 20 kilometres west of Campobasso and about 20 kilometres east of Isernia.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Molise
Village
Molise is a comune in the Province of Campobasso in the Italian region Molise, located about 15 kilometres northwest of Campobasso. As of 31 December 2004, it had a population of 179 and an area of 5.2 square kilometres. Molise is situated 5 km northeast of Frosolone.
Chiauci
Village
Photo: Alessiocav,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Chiauci is a comune in the Province of Isernia in the Italian region Molise, located about 25 kilometres northwest of Campobasso and about 15 kilometres northeast of Isernia. Chiauci is situated 10 km northwest of Frosolone.
